What is Bo Bun?
Bo Bun combines rice vermicelli, crisp vegetables, onion-fried beef, fresh herbs, roasted peanuts and a lightly tangy nuoc mam sauce.
The result is fresh, fragrant and satisfying. Served between warm and cool, it works just as well in summer as in the cooler seasons.
